21xrx.com
2024-12-23 01:08:44 Monday
登录
文章检索 我的文章 写文章
C++中如何声明常量(const)?
2023-06-23 01:15:55 深夜i     --     --
C++ 声明 常量 const

在C++中,常量是指值不会改变的变量。使用常量可以提高代码的可读性、可维护性和安全性。常量可以用于存储任何类型的数据,如整数、字符、字符串、浮点数等。要声明常量,需要使用关键字“const”。

常量的声明格式如下:

const data_type constant_name = value;

其中,“data_type”表示常量的数据类型,“constant_name”表示常量的名称,“value”表示常量的值。除了使用常量名之外,还可以使用宏定义和枚举类型来声明常量。

常量的命名规则和变量相同,可以包含字母、数字和下划线,但必须以字母开头。常量名一般使用大写字母进行命名,以与变量区分。

例如,要声明一个整数常量为100,可以使用以下代码:

const int NUMBER = 100;

同样,也可以使用宏定义声明常量:

#define NUMBER 100

在使用常量时,不能对其赋值或修改其值。否则会导致编译错误或运行时错误。因此,常量的值在编译时就已经确定了,而变量的值则可以在程序运行过程中发生变化。

通过使用常量,可以使代码更加清晰易懂,避免因改变常量值而引起的错误,提高代码的可维护性和可读性。在C++中,使用常量已成为一种推荐的良好编程习惯,许多标准库函数也使用常量作为输入和输出参数。因此,掌握常量的使用方法对于C++程序员来说是非常重要的。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复